2 - Purposes of processing personal data
Personal data collected through the TalentoHQ website and Platform is processed to manage registration on the Platform, activate the free trial, enter into the contract, provide the service as software as a service (SaaS), manage the contractual relationship, issue invoices, manage payments and direct debits, including bank details such as the IBAN account number, and respond to enquiries, incidents and technical support requests.
The data may also be processed to comply with legal obligations relating to tax, accounting, commercial and data protection matters and to send communications concerning the contracted service.
When the software is used, TalentoHQ may process personal data entered by the Customer relating to employees or collaborators, including identification data, contact details, professional and employment data, working-time records, clock-in and clock-out records, geolocation data associated with clocking in when that feature is enabled, document management information and any other information required for the proper provision of the service.
In these cases, TalentoHQ acts as the Data Processor on behalf of the Customer, who acts as the Data Controller, in accordance with Article 28 of Regulation (EU) 2016/679 and the corresponding Data Processing Agreement.

5 - Data retention
Personal data will be retained for as long as necessary to provide the service and while the contractual relationship remains in force.
Once the relationship has ended, the data will be retained for the periods required by applicable tax, commercial and administrative legislation, generally for a maximum of six years under commercial law and four years under tax law, unless a different period applies or the data is required to establish, exercise or defend legal claims.
Bank details will be retained while the contractual relationship remains in force and subsequently for the periods legally required to address any liabilities arising from the financial relationship.
Where data is processed in the capacity of Data Processor, its retention and subsequent deletion or return will be carried out in accordance with the Data Processing Agreement.

11 - First-party website analytics
The marketing website measures visits, campaign landings and completed demo or trial outcomes with first-party technology. It does not set analytics cookies and does not use third-party advertising pixels.
On each page the server records a visit from the request (including a masked IP address, browser family, referrer and campaign parameters in the URL). If JavaScript runs, the browser may also keep a random identifier named talentohq_analytics_id_v1 in local storage for 30 days. That value is sent to TalentoHQ only as a keyed digest, so we can recognise the same browser across sessions and attribute a completed trial. Raw user-agent strings and precise location are not kept. Visit records are deleted after 90 days; de-identified campaign facts may be kept for up to 25 months.
This processing supports the legitimate interest of understanding how the website is used and whether campaigns lead to a demo or a trial, without building an advertising profile. You can delete the local identifier by clearing this site’s stored data in your browser. More detail is in the Cookie Policy.
